The board shall investigate all complaints concerning any person licensed under the
provisions of KRS Chapter 317A. The board may on its own volition initiate such
an investigation and shall promulgate such rules and regulations necessary for the
administration of the provisions of this section. (2) If upon investigation there appears to be a violation of the provisions of KRS Chapter 317A, the board shall take such action as it deems necessary under the
provisions of KRS 317A.140. Effective: July 15, 1980
History: Created 1980 Ky. Acts ch. 202, sec. 6, effective July 15, 1980.
